Grilled Mango White Balsamic Chicken

Description:
Juicy chicken breasts marinated in a sweet‐tart blend of mango white balsamic vinegar, garlic, olive oil, and honey, then grilled to perfection for a summery dish.

Ingredients:

  • 4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
  • 1/3 cup mango white balsamic vinegar
  • 2 tbsp olive oil
  • 2 garlic cloves, minced
  • 1 tbsp honey (optional)
  • Salt and pepper, to taste
  • A pinch of red pepper flakes (optional)
  • Fresh basil for garnish

Instructions:

  1. In a bowl, whisk together the vinegar, olive oil, garlic, honey, salt, pepper, and red pepper flakes.
  2. Place the chicken in a zip-top bag or shallow dish; pour in the marinade and refrigerate for 30–120 minutes.
  3. Preheat your grill to medium-high and oil the grates lightly.
  4. Grill the chicken 5–7 minutes per side (depending on thickness) until the internal temperature reaches 165°F (75°C).
  5. Let rest for 5 minutes, then slice and garnish with basil.

Baked Chicken Thighs with Mango White Balsamic Glaze

Description:
Bone-in chicken thighs that soak up a vibrant glaze, creating a caramelized finish perfect for a comforting family dinner.

Ingredients:

  • 6 bone-in, skin-on chicken thighs
  • 1/3 cup mango white balsamic vinegar
  • 2 tbsp olive oil
  • 2 garlic cloves, minced
  • 1 tbsp soy sauce
  • 1 tsp dried thyme or rosemary
  • 1 tsp honey (optional)
  • Salt and pepper, to taste

Instructions:

  1. Preheat the oven to 400°F (200°C).
  2. Mix vinegar, olive oil, garlic, soy sauce, thyme (or rosemary), honey, salt, and pepper in a bowl.
  3. Pat chicken dry, season with salt and pepper, and sear in an oven-safe skillet (skin side down) for 3–4 minutes until golden.
  4. Flip the chicken, pour the glaze over, and bake for 25–30 minutes until the internal temperature reaches 165°F (75°C).
  5. Optionally, broil for the last 2–3 minutes for extra caramelization.

Mango White Balsamic Chicken Stir-Fry

Description:
A quick and colorful stir-fry featuring tender chicken and crisp vegetables in a zesty mango white balsamic sauce.

Ingredients:

  • 2 chicken breasts, thinly sliced
  • 3 tbsp mango white balsamic vinegar
  • 1 tbsp soy sauce
  • 2 garlic cloves, minced
  • 1 tsp grated ginger
  • 1 red bell pepper, sliced
  • 1 cup broccoli florets
  • 1 cup snap peas
  • 2 tbsp olive oil
  • Salt and pepper, to taste

Instructions:

  1. Marinate the chicken slices in 2 tbsp vinegar, soy sauce, garlic, ginger, salt, and pepper for 20 minutes.
  2. Heat olive oil in a large pan or wok over medium-high heat.
  3. Stir-fry the vegetables until crisp-tender (about 3–4 minutes).
  4. Add the chicken and remaining marinade; stir-fry until the chicken is cooked through.
  5. Serve immediately over rice or noodles.

Mango White Balsamic Chicken Risotto

Description:
A creamy, comforting risotto infused with tender chicken and finished with a drizzle of mango white balsamic reduction.

Ingredients:

  • 1 cup Arborio rice
  • 4 cups chicken broth, kept warm
  • 2 chicken breasts, diced
  • 1/3 cup mango white balsamic vinegar
  • 1 small onion, finely chopped
  • 2 garlic cloves, minced
  • 1/2 cup white wine (optional)
  • 1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• 2 tbsp olive oil
  • Salt, pepper, and chopped parsley

Instructions:

  1. In a large pan, sauté onion and garlic in olive oil until translucent.
  2. Add Arborio rice and toast for 1–2 minutes, then deglaze with white wine if using.
  3. Gradually stir in warm chicken broth, one ladle at a time, until the rice is creamy and tender.
  4. Meanwhile, sauté diced chicken (pre-marinated with a splash of mango vinegar, salt, and pepper) until cooked through.
  5. Stir the chicken and a drizzle of extra mango vinegar into the risotto, finish with Parmesan and parsley.

Mango White Balsamic Chicken Pot Pie

Description:
A comforting pot pie filled with tender chicken and mixed vegetables, elevated by a subtle mango white balsamic twist.

Ingredients:

  • 2 cups diced chicken
  • 1/3 cup mango white balsamic vinegar
  • 1 cup mixed vegetables (peas, carrots, potatoes)
  • 1 onion, diced
  • 2 garlic cloves, minced
  • 2 cups chicken broth
  • 2 tbsp flour
  • 2 tbsp butter
  • 1 package pie crust (top and bottom)
  • Salt, pepper, and 1 tsp thyme

Instructions:

  1.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C).
  2. In a skillet, melt butter and sauté onion and garlic; stir in flour to form a roux.
  3. Add chicken (tossed in mango vinegar), vegetables, and chicken broth; simmer until thickened.
  4. Roll out pie crusts in a baking dish, fill with the chicken mixture, cover with the top crust, and seal the edges.
  5. Bake for 30–35 minutes until golden brown.
